PDF/AをPDF形式に変換する
Contents
[
Hide
]
PDF/AドキュメントをPDFに変換する
PDF/AドキュメントをPDFに変換することは、元のドキュメントからPDF/Aの制限を除去することを意味します。クラスDocumentには、入力/ソースファイルからPDFの準拠情報を削除するためのメソッドremovePdfaCompliance(..)があります。
// 入力ファイルでDocumentクラスの新しいインスタンスを作成します
$document = new Document($inputFile);
// ドキュメントからPDF/A準拠を削除します
$document->removePdfaCompliance();
// 変更されたドキュメントを出力ファイルに保存します
$document->save($outputFile);
この情報は、ドキュメントに変更を加えた場合にも削除されます(例: ページを追加します)。次の例では、ページを追加した後、出力ドキュメントがPDF/A準拠を失います。
// 入力ファイルでDocumentクラスの新しいインスタンスを作成します
$document = new Document($inputFile);
// ドキュメントからPDF/A準拠を削除します
$document->getPages()->add();
// 修正されたドキュメントを出力ファイルに保存します
$document->save($outputFile);